Helicopters vs Bush Planes Which Is Best for Aerial Photography?
Choosing the right aircraft affects your photographic flexibility, stability, and comfort during your safari. Understanding the benefits of helicopters and bush planes helps you plan an efficient and productive aerial photography experience.
Advantages of Helicopter Safari Kenya Routes
Helicopters offer unmatched maneuverability, allowing pilots to adjust altitude, hover, and circle around wildlife for dynamic angles. This makes them ideal for capturing fast-moving animals and dramatic landscape compositions.
Why Bush Planes Are Great for Stable Shots
Bush planes provide a spacious, stable platform, reducing vibrations and enabling photographers to use larger lenses. Their endurance allows for longer flights, covering vast territories and multiple wildlife hotspots in a single session.

Expert Photographic Tips for Aerial Wildlife Shoots
Capturing stunning aerial images requires more than just being in the air — it takes skill, preparation, and the right approach to photography.
Camera Settings for Birds-Eye Views
Use fast shutter speeds to minimize motion blur, continuous autofocus to track moving animals, and optimal ISO settings to maintain clarity in changing light conditions.
Best Times of Day for Lighting
The golden hours after sunrise and before sunset provide dramatic shadows and rich colors, enhancing the depth and texture of your aerial photographs.
Framing Wildlife from Above
Compose shots to include natural patterns such as herd formations, rivers, and landscape lines. This approach adds storytelling, scale, and artistic impact to your images.

Gear Essentials for Aerial Wildlife Photography Safaris
Choosing the right equipment is critical to achieving professional-quality aerial photographs.
Lenses, Filters & Memory Cards
Telephoto lenses (70-200mm or longer) are essential for capturing wildlife details. Polarizing filters reduce atmospheric haze, while high-speed memory cards ensure you never miss a shot.
Stabilization Tools and Mounts
Beanbags, camera harnesses, or other stabilization aids help reduce vibration and allow smoother shooting from moving aircraft.
Travel-Friendly Photography Kit
Lightweight, dust-proof equipment is ideal for fly-in safaris, where aircraft space is limited. Pack smartly to maintain mobility and ensure all essential gear is accessible.
Seasonal Calendar When to Capture Kenya’s Best Aerial Shots
Timing your aerial safari can dramatically enhance the quality and uniqueness of your photographs. Kenya’s wildlife and landscapes change with the seasons, offering photographers opportunities for both dramatic and serene compositions.
Great Migration Peak Times
From July to October, the Maasai Mara hosts the spectacular Great Migration. Thousands of wildebeest and zebras cross rivers, creating iconic aerial photography opportunities with dynamic herd formations and predator-prey interactions.
Dry Season Photography
During the dry season (June to October), golden savannahs and dusty plains create striking contrasts with wildlife. Waterholes attract elephants, giraffes, and other animals, making them easy to photograph from above.
Wet Season Photography
The wet season (November to May) brings lush greenery and vibrant landscapes. Rivers swell, lakes reflect dramatic skies, and seasonal birds and wildlife activity provide varied photographic subjects.
